One day from the glorious weekend! Definitely ready to spend some time on the couch, watching football. In the news this morning, we had updates on the wildfires raging in California, what's going to be open/closed today in honor of Jimmy Carter's funeral, an update on the suspect in the shooting deaths of three people in New Lisbon, and the Mexican President responding to Trump renaming the Gulf of Mexico. In sports, the Bucks got a big win over the Spurs last night, the Badger men's basketball team looks to stay hot tomorrow night against the Gophers, former WI QB Tyler Van Dyke is headed to SMU, a rundown of the upcoming CFP Bowl Games and this weekend's NFL action…plus, an update on Jordan Love. We let you know what's on TV tonight and we talked to Office Cora about what's happening in the 715 this weekend. According to a scary new report, 41% of employers plan on downsizing by 2030 as more jobs become victims of A.I. On the flipside of that disturbing news, check out this story about a guy who found his birth mother in a bakery that he frequented! There's a college in England that is offering a class on how to make phone calls because of Telophobia. Yeah, it's a thing. Checked in on Alexander Ovechkin's goal total as he chases Wayne Gretzky's record, and the NHL announced it's outdoor games for 2026. Had a new "Karen of the Day" at an airport, and a sports reporter got busted looking at some lingerie while on the job. And in today's edition of "Bad News with Happy Music", we had stories about a Wisconsin man who was caught masturbating outside of a grocery store, a woman in Cleveland who was killed by her neighbor's pigs, and a racist who got a big-ass shiner after getting punched in the face.
